What are the tax implications of using Robinhood for cryptocurrency trading?

- Dorsey ChristoffersenJan 22, 2024 · 2 years agoWhen it comes to using Robinhood for cryptocurrency trading, it's important to consider the tax implications. The IRS treats cryptocurrencies as property, which means that any gains or losses from trading are subject to capital gains tax. This means that if you make a profit from your cryptocurrency trades on Robinhood, you will need to report it on your tax return and pay taxes on the gains. On the other hand, if you incur losses, you may be able to deduct them from your overall taxable income. It's crucial to keep accurate records of your trades and consult with a tax professional to ensure compliance with tax regulations.
